Hawai‘i Volcanoes National Park protects some of the most unique geological, biological, and cherished cultural landscapes in the world. Extending from sea level to 13,680 feet, the park encompasses the summits of two of the world's most active volcanoes - Kīlauea and Mauna Loa - and is a designated International Biosphere Reserve and UNESCO World Heritage Site. Welcome to the Volcano House Hotel in Hawai'i, a historical retreat located in Hawai'i Volcanoes National Park.Kīlauea is the youngest and most active volcano on the island of Hawaiʻi, and one of the busiest in the world. In recorded history, Kīlauea has only had short periods of repose. It has covered almost 90% of its surface in lava flows within the last 1,000 years. Welcome to a world that shelters an array of Hawaiian native species including a host of fascinating birds, carnivorous caterpillars, the largest dragonfly in the United States, crickets partial to new lava flows, endangered sea turtles and just one native terrestrial mammal - a bat. Although Kīlauea and Mauna Loa are by far the most active, they combine with three other volcanoes to make up the Island of Hawaiʻi. Mauna Kea, Hualālai, and Kohala all loom to the north of Hawaiʻi Volcanoes National Park.
